Mitie Cleaning & Hygiene Services is looking for a seasoned Quantity Surveyor to support various projects in Glasgow, Scotland. The ideal candidate will have over 8 years of experience in the construction industry, particularly within the utilities sector, and will be adept at leading commercial teams.
Key responsibilities include:
- Managing subcontractor negotiations
- Dispute resolutions
- Providing contractual support to site managers
This role emphasizes commercial acumen and stakeholder management, with a commitment to equality and diversity in recruitment.

How to prepare for a job interview at Mitie Cleaning & Hygiene Services
✨Know Your Numbers
As a Quantity Surveyor, you’ll need to demonstrate your commercial acumen. Brush up on key financial metrics and project budgets relevant to the utilities sector. Be ready to discuss how you've managed costs and maximised value in past projects.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Since this role involves leading commercial teams, prepare examples of how you've successfully managed teams in the past. Highlight your approach to motivating team members and resolving conflicts, as well as any specific outcomes that resulted from your leadership.
✨Prepare for Negotiation Scenarios
Negotiating with subcontractors is a big part of this job. Think of a few challenging negotiation situations you've faced and how you handled them. Be prepared to discuss your strategies and the results, showcasing your ability to achieve win-win outcomes.
✨Emphasise Stakeholder Management
Stakeholder management is crucial in this role. Prepare to talk about how you've built relationships with various stakeholders in previous projects. Discuss your communication style and how you ensure everyone is aligned and informed throughout the project lifecycle.
